Who you’ll be supporting & more about the role: The role will see you building and maintaining Community Integrated Care’s Capability Framework for our frontline colleagues that defines the knowledge, skills and behaviour for each role in enabling the people we support to live the best life possible, meeting all organisational and regulatory requirements. Delivering the Capability Framework is a strategic priority for the Charity. It is a key enabler of our engagement strategy to ensure our frontline colleagues are suitably supported to succeed in their role, through the development opportunities they have access to. Training provision within Community Integrated Care is delivered through a network of geographically aligned Learning & Development Team Leaders and Specialists, external partners and eLearning. It is the responsibility of the Capability Development Team to define the capability standards of our frontline roles, that in turn set the learning objectives for our training Day to Day (list not exhaustive see attached job description)
